misc: adjust map behaviours and controls (#41466) #681

Merged
fpeters merged 1 commits from wip/41466-map-zoom-gestures into main 2023-09-19 16:54:09 +02:00
Owner
No description provided.
fpeters added 1 commit 2023-09-16 11:41:34 +02:00
gitea/wcs/pipeline/head This commit looks good Details
889c0fc933
misc: adjust map behaviours and controls (#41466)
* always enable gesture controls
* always requires Ctrl to zoom
* do not include search button on readonly maps
* do not include zoom buttons on small maps
Author
Owner

J'ai mis dans https://dev.entrouvert.org/issues/41466#note-2 du contexte sur ce que j'ai décidé de faire ici, mais je mets une copie ici aussi :

J'ai remonté le changement de comportement, à la base c'était #25828 ("Ne pas permettre le déplacement dans la carte sur la page de validation") qui demandait à ne pas pouvoir déplacer une carte en lecture seule (sur la page de validation.

Mais ça laisse le zoom, et si on active le mode "gestures", pour avoir le message "vous pouvez zoomer avec ctrl-molette", ça réétablit la possibilité de se déplacer dans la carte.

Je décide de tout reprendre pour avoir :

  • tout le temps la possibilité de zoomer/déplacer, avec le mode "gestures" activé pour avoir le message,
  • de ne pas inclure le bouton de recherche sur les cartes lecture seule,
  • de ne pas inclure les boutons de zoom sur les petites cartes (dans le tableau de traitement ou en barre latérale).

Alternativement, pour répondre strictement à ce ticket, la modification aurait été de faire la désactivation totale zoom/déplacement/gesture en visant uniquement le cas "page de validation", mais j'ai trouvé que ça faisait bizarre, et que la demande initiale ne justifiait pas d'avoir juste un cas particulier.

J'ai mis dans https://dev.entrouvert.org/issues/41466#note-2 du contexte sur ce que j'ai décidé de faire ici, mais je mets une copie ici aussi : J'ai remonté le changement de comportement, à la base c'était #25828 ("Ne pas permettre le déplacement dans la carte sur la page de validation") qui demandait à ne pas pouvoir déplacer une carte en lecture seule (sur la page de validation. Mais ça laisse le zoom, et si on active le mode "gestures", pour avoir le message "vous pouvez zoomer avec ctrl-molette", ça réétablit la possibilité de se déplacer dans la carte. Je décide de tout reprendre pour avoir : * tout le temps la possibilité de zoomer/déplacer, avec le mode "gestures" activé pour avoir le message, * de ne pas inclure le bouton de recherche sur les cartes lecture seule, * de ne pas inclure les boutons de zoom sur les petites cartes (dans le tableau de traitement ou en barre latérale). Alternativement, pour répondre strictement à ce ticket, la modification aurait été de faire la désactivation totale zoom/déplacement/gesture en visant uniquement le cas "page de validation", mais j'ai trouvé que ça faisait bizarre, et que la demande initiale ne justifiait pas d'avoir juste un cas particulier.
csechet approved these changes 2023-09-19 16:42:02 +02:00
fpeters merged commit eb0ac023c6 into main 2023-09-19 16:54:09 +02:00
fpeters deleted branch wip/41466-map-zoom-gestures 2023-09-19 16:54:09 +02:00
Sign in to join this conversation.
No reviewers
No Label
No Milestone
No Assignees
2 Participants
Notifications
Due Date
The due date is invalid or out of range. Please use the format 'yyyy-mm-dd'.

No due date set.

Dependencies

No dependencies set.

Reference: entrouvert/wcs#681
No description provided.